System.IO.Hashing 9.0.0
About
System.IO.Hashing offers a variety of hash code algorithms.
Hash code algorithms are pivotal for generating unique values for objects based on their content, facilitating object comparisons, and detecting content alterations. The namespace encompasses algorithms like CRC-32, CRC-64, xxHash3, xxHash32, xxHash64, and xxHash128, all engineered for swift and efficient hash code generation, with xxHash being an "Extremely fast hash algorithm".
Warning: The hash functions provided by System.IO.Hashing are not suitable for security purposes such as handling passwords or verifying untrusted content. For such security-critical applications, consider using cryptographic hash functions provided by the System.Security.Cryptography namespace.
Key Features
- Variety of hash code algorithms including CRC-32, CRC-64, xxHash3, xxHash32, xxHash64, and xxHash128.
- Implementations of CRC-32 and CRC-64 algorithms, as used in IEEE 802.3, and described in ECMA-182, Annex B respectively.
- Implementations of XxHash32 for generating 32-bit hashes, XxHash3 and XxHash64 for generating 64-bit hashes, and xxHash128 for generating 128-bit hashes.
How to Use
Creating hash codes is straightforward.
Call the Hash method with the content to be hashed.
Here is a practical example:
using System;
using System.IO.Hashing;
byte[] data = new byte[] { 1, 2, 3, 4 };
byte[] crc32Value = Crc32.Hash(data);
Console.WriteLine($"CRC-32 Hash: {BitConverter.ToString(crc32Value)}");
// CRC-32 Hash: CD-FB-3C-B6
byte[] crc64Value = Crc64.Hash(data);
Console.WriteLine($"CRC-64 Hash: {BitConverter.ToString(crc64Value)}");
// CRC-64 Hash: 58-8D-5A-D4-2A-70-1D-B2
byte[] xxHash3Value = XxHash3.Hash(data);
Console.WriteLine($"XxHash3 Hash: {BitConverter.ToString(xxHash3Value)}");
// XxHash3 Hash: 98-8B-7B-90-33-AC-46-22
byte[] xxHash32Value = XxHash32.Hash(data);
Console.WriteLine($"XxHash32 Hash: {BitConverter.ToString(xxHash32Value)}");
// XxHash32 Hash: FE-96-D1-9C
byte[] xxHash64Value = XxHash64.Hash(data);
Console.WriteLine($"XxHash64 Hash: {BitConverter.ToString(xxHash64Value)}");
// XxHash64 Hash: 54-26-20-E3-A2-A9-2E-D1
byte[] xxHash128Value = XxHash128.Hash(data);
Console.WriteLine($"XxHash128 Hash: {BitConverter.ToString(xxHash128Value)}");
// XxHash128 Hash: 49-A0-48-99-59-7A-35-67-53-76-53-A0-D9-95-5B-86
